The property

Westpoint is a contemporary holiday home in the small coastal village of Polzeath, set in an elevated position, just a five-minute walk from beach.

Offering sociable, light and bright living across two floors, this four-bedroom property is a wonderful base for an extended family, or group of eight people looking to discover North Cornwall’s beautiful beaches and harbours.

Take in the mesmerising sea view from the sitting room, boasting sliding doors that frame the surrounding coastline and make the room flow into the furnished terrace and garden.

Alternatively, on wintery days, make the most of the Jetmaster fire to warm up by after blustery beach walks, or if you’re brave enough, chilly wild swims! Whether you are looking to prepare a picnic, Cornish cream tea or feast to enjoy indoors or alfresco, the well-equipped, stylish kitchen caters for your holiday requirements and even features the original Aga.

Open-plan, the kitchen flows into the dining area, where natural light floods through, creating an inviting space to gather round the table and indulge in delicious dinners. Making the most of the beautiful surrounding coastline, all three first floor bedrooms boast stunning sea views, including a double en-suite bedroom with a king-size bed, an additional double room and twin room.

On the ground floor, there’s a nautical twin bedroom to rest tired heads. With a family bathroom, shower room and an en-suite bathroom, there’s plenty of space for guests to shower off sand and salt following an afternoon of sandcastle building, and even soak tired limbs. On sunny days, the terrace and garden really takes centre stage, offering ample room to play garden games and enjoy a refreshing beverage overlooking the seaside. To the left of the property, a track leads to Polzeath’s popular surfing beach at the heart of the village, where you’ll also find surrounding businesses offering watersport equipment hire, cafés, shops and restaurants, as well as the South West Coast Path inviting explorers to discover the coastline.

Further afield is the chic village of Rock (3 miles), home to Paul Ainsworth’s popular restaurant ‘The Mariners’, a beautiful shingle beach, boutique shops and cafés.

Or, hop aboard the ferry from Rock to visit the popular harbour town of Padstow for more award-winning restaurants and the famous Camel Trail for cyclists of all abilities.

Westpoint is a wonderful holiday home for families or groups, that’s ideally situated in an elevated position in Polzeath to enjoy beautiful views, yet is within just a short walk of the village’s amenities.

About the location

WADEBRIDGE

Padstow 9 miles; Newquay 16 miles.

The bustling market town of Wadebridge is perfectly placed alongside the ebb and flow of the River Camel, an ideal location for exploring the natural beauty of North Cornwall. The town hosts an array of excellent shops, pubs and restaurants, all offering a personal and friendly service and is home to North Cornwall's only family-owned cinema. The beautiful countryside surrounding the town is criss-crossed with a network of local footpaths, amazing gardens and stately homes to explore, whilst the renowned Camel Trail passes through the town, providing 17 miles of fabulous, traffic free walking, horse riding and cycling opportunities. The stunning North Cornwall coast is within 5 miles, boasting a huge selection of beaches, rocky coves and towering cliffs to explore and the nearby town of Padstow, with its colourful harbour, pastel-washed, medieval houses and celebrated restaurants is a must. Visit the UK surfing capital of Newquay, with over 11 miles of golden sandy beaches, a fascinating sea life centre, exciting zoo and vibrant nightspots. Whatever your desire, there's something for everyone in this terrific holiday location.
